Early Origins and Development
SKA-Khabarovsk was founded in 1946, originally as a team connected to the Soviet Army sports structure. During the Soviet era, the uu88 com club was known as SKA Khabarovsk and competed primarily in the Soviet First and Second Leagues. These formative years helped create the foundations of a competitive team that would go on to earn recognition nationwide.
The club plays its home matches at the historic Lenin Stadium, one of the largest venues in the Russian Far East. It provides a passionate atmosphere where supporters, despite the long distances and harsh weather conditions, consistently show up to cheer for their team.
Rise in Russian Football
After the dissolution of the Soviet Union, SKA-Khabarovsk continued its football journey within the Russian league system, spending most of its time in the Russian First Division (now known as the Russian First League). The club became known for its defensive discipline, physical style of play, and ability to compete with bigger, better-funded teams.
A major milestone came in 2017, when SKA-Khabarovsk achieved promotion to the Russian Premier League for the first time in its history. This achievement marked a proud moment for the entire Far Eastern region. Although the club spent only one season at the top level, its participation demonstrated the strength and potential of football outside the traditional power centers.
